  17. Sheilb4. I have a question about making reservations for the specialty restaurants and the star class. Did you have to make reservations ahead of time (before the cruise) for any of the specialty restaurants or is the genie able to book reservations for any specialty restaurant once on board the ship? Thanks for the review. Looking forward the reading more.

     

    Hi! closer to the cruise I received another email from the Genie with suggestions of restaurants and shows so that all the times coordinated. I had him tweak it a bit per our taste, ie didn’t want to eat at Giovannis so replaced it with Izumi x 2 nights as an example. It all worked out great, if you want to change your mind with restaurant selection, even once onboard, it’s easy. the Genie will do whatever you need to make it fit your needs. Hope this helps.
